Taxiway Delta has been designed to link up to the main apron as the taxiway goes up hill after is passes the east apron as the main apron sits on higher ground than the new east apron. The taxiway can’t be connected to the main apron until new stands are built just north of the east apron because by connecting Delta to the main apron will result in the closure of stands 9 and 9L and due to insufficient clearance.

The piers and north apron was meant to be built as part of the original project but pressure from easyjet to cut costs meant that this work was postponed to a later date. easyJet have made it clear that they do not want any airbridges built on the main apron as they want passenger to board from the front and rear doors to speed up turnarounds So for all you easyjet pilots some of the blame can be put at the door of your management.
